Three contract killers,one of whom is allegedly linked to Dawood Ibrahim,were arrested on Friday. They were involved in murder and robbery cases,police said.
The accused have been identified as Mahesh (25),the alleged mastermind who also had links with Dawood,and his associates Vipin (28) and Rakesh (30).
Mahesh had murdered an alleged criminal,Naresh of Bareilly. Three were arrested earlier in cases of murder,attempt to murder,robbery and under the Gangster Act. We have recovered three country made pistols,eight live cartridges and a stolen motorcycle from their possession, said Deputy Commissioner of Police (West) V Renganathan.
Mahesh is allegedly involved in 10 cases,Vipin in eight and Rakesh in 20 cases.
During interrogation,Mahesh reportedly told the police that he wanted to become a gangster as he was weak in studies and pursued his education only till Class IX. He said he drew inspiration from Dawoods work.
